AddressBase Plus Islands structure

AddressBase Plus is structured as a flat file. The data structure in this document is described by means of Unified Modeling Language (UML) class diagrams.

Definition: The address of a property or object which is defined as the main/preferred address by Pointer, Isle of Man Property database, Channel Islands Address File (CAF), Ordnance Survey or Royal Mail.

The diagram below shows the UML model of AddressBase Plus Islands in CSV format; classes from the Ordnance Survey product specification are orange; code lists are blue, and enumerations are green.

The diagram below shows the UML model of AddressBase Plus Islands in GML; classes from the Ordnance Survey product specification are orange, code lists are blue and enumerations are green.

As the attribute ‘position’ is voidable this is displayed at the bottom of the UML model, but this is not where it will be provided in terms of ordering in the product supply. Please see the attribute tables to confirm the attribute ordering.
